How correlated are AMBO and SPY?

On 3 years of weekly data the AMBO/SPY correlation comes out at -0.00, near zero, meaning they move largely independently. Little has changed lately, as the 1-year reading of -0.08 lands near the 3-year figure. The 5-year figure is 0.02, and annualized covariance runs at -0.4 %².

Out of 11 assets tracked against AMBO, SPY lands near the bottom at #7. Their recent paths diverged sharply: over the last 12 months SPY outperformed by 63.0 percentage points (-42.4% for AMBO against +20.6% for SPY). Note the risk asymmetry: AMBO runs 10.1 times the annualized volatility of the other leg, so equal-weighting the two is not an equal-risk position.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of -0.00 mean?

On the −1 to +1 scale, -0.00 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
